Broken Springs
Effectively working garage door elements are crucial for reliable procedure, and among one of the most vital aspects is the garage door springs. These springs are accountable for counterbalancing the weight of the door, making it possible for smooth opening and closing. Gradually, they can wear or break because of steel exhaustion, improper installation, or absence of upkeep.When a springtime breaks, the garage door might end up being unusable, often remaining embeded either the shut or open placement. Trying to operate a garage door with a broken springtime can result in additional damage to the door or its components. Signs of a busted springtime consist of an unequal door, loud noises when attempting to open up, or a visible space in the spring itself.
Fixing or replacing broken springtimes is a job best entrusted to experts, as this includes dealing with high-tension mechanisms why not check here that can be hazardous otherwise handled correctly. Property owners should never ever try to fix the springtimes on their own. Normal upkeep checks can help recognize damage before springtimes break, making certain the garage door operates efficiently and securely.
Remote Issues
Remote control concerns can substantially hinder the capability of a garage door system, influencing both ease and safety. Garage Door Repair Victor. A defective push-button control can originate from different aspects, including dead batteries, disturbance, or programming mistakesThe very first step in fixing remote control problems is to examine the batteries. Changing the batteries is a efficient and basic solution if the remote stops working to run the door. If battery substitute does not fix the concern, consider the possibility of superhigh frequency disturbance. Items such as fluorescent lights, electronic gadgets, and also bordering garage door remotes can disrupt the signal.
Additionally, reprogramming the remote may be needed. Seek advice from the garage door opener's guidebook for details directions on just how to reset and synchronize the remote with the opener.
If the remote still does not function after these actions, it may be time to check the remote itself for physical damage or think about purchasing a substitute. Normal maintenance of the garage door system, including the remote, can prevent such issues and guarantee smooth procedure, boosting both use and security.
